概括
心血管疾病 (CVD) 显著增加关节骨折的风险. 共同的遗传因素,而不仅仅是生活方式,有助于CVD和骨质疏松性骨折之间的这种联系.

背景情况:
- 新出现的证据将心血管疾病 (CVD) 与骨质疏松性骨折联系起来.
- 对于这些常见的疾病,人们怀疑有共同的潜在病因.
研究的目的:
- 调查心血管疾病与随后的关节骨折风险之间的关联.
- 通过双胞胎研究设计,确定遗传和生活方式因素在这种关系中的作用.
主要方法:
- 从50岁开始对31,936名瑞典双胞胎 (出生于1914年至1944年) 进行了跟踪.
- 心血管疾病 (CVD) 和关节骨折数据从国家登记处 (1964-2005) 收集.
- 考克斯的比例危险回归模型分析了依赖时间的暴露.
主要成果:
- 心血管疾病的诊断与大大增加的关节骨折率有关 (例如,心力衰竭HR=4.40,中风HR=5.09).
- 即使是没有心血管疾病诊断的双胞胎也显示关节骨折风险较高,这表明他们有共同的遗传影响.
- 在伪暴露的双胞胎中,关节骨折的危险比为心力衰竭的3.74,中风的2.29.
结论:
- 心血管疾病是随后部骨折的重要危险因素.
- 在双胞胎中观察到的风险增加表明,一种遗传成分是心血管疾病与骨质疏松性骨折关联的基础.
